Bluehost Migration Guide: Step‑by‑Step to a Smooth Transfer

Introduction

Moving a website to a new host can feel intimidating, but with the right plan you can avoid downtime, preserve SEO value, and keep your visitors happy. This Bluehost migration guide walks you through every stage—pre‑migration prep, the actual transfer, and post‑migration checks—so even beginners can complete a seamless move.

Why Choose Bluehost for Migration?

Bluehost is popular for its user‑friendly dashboard, 24/7 support, and free site‑transfer tools. Whether you’re moving from a shared host, a VPS, or a competitor’s platform, Bluehost provides:

  • One‑click WordPress migration plugin
  • Free SSL and domain management
  • Scalable plans that grow with your traffic

Pre‑Migration Checklist

1. Back Up Your Current Site

Always start with a full backup. Use your current host’s backup utility or a plugin like UpdraftPlus. Save both the file system and the database.

2. Make a List of Essentials

  • Domain registrar details
  • Database credentials (username, password, host)
  • Custom scripts, .htaccess rules, and email accounts

3. Test Locally

Set up a local copy with XAMPP or Local by Flywheel. This gives you a safe sandbox to verify that the site works before the live switch.

Step‑by‑Step Migration Process

Step 1 – Purchase a Bluehost Plan

Select a plan that matches your current resources. For most beginners, the Basic or Plus plan is enough, but WordPress‑heavy sites may need a VPS.

Step 2 – Add Your Domain to Bluehost

In the Bluehost dashboard, go to Domains → Assign. Choose “Assign to a site” and follow the prompts. If your domain is registered elsewhere, update the nameservers to ns1.bluehost.com and ns2.bluehost.com.

Step 3 – Use the Bluehost Migration Plugin (WordPress)

  1. Log into your WordPress admin on the old host.
  2. Install the Bluehost Migration plugin.
  3. Enter your new Bluehost site URL and generate an API key.
  4. Run the migration; the plugin copies files and the database automatically.

The process usually finishes in 10–30 minutes depending on site size.

Step 4 – Manual Migration (Non‑WordPress Sites)

  1. Export your database via phpMyAdmin (or use mysqldump).
  2. Upload website files via FTP/SFTP to public_html on Bluehost.
  3. Create a new MySQL database in the Bluehost cPanel and import the SQL file.
  4. Update wp-config.php (or your custom config) with the new DB credentials.

Step 5 – Verify DNS Propagation

After changing nameservers, propagation can take up to 48 hours. Use tools like whatsmydns.net to confirm that yourdomain.com points to Bluehost globally.

Post‑Migration Checklist

  • Check all pages, forms, and media for broken links.
  • Test e‑mail accounts and forwarding rules.
  • Enable the free SSL in Bluehost and force HTTPS via .htaccess.
  • Run a speed test (GTmetrix or PageSpeed Insights) and adjust caching if needed.
  • Submit an updated XML sitemap to Google Search Console.

FAQ

Do I need to cancel my old hosting account?

Wait until the DNS fully propagates and you’ve confirmed the new site works. Then you can safely cancel or downgrade.

Will my SEO rankings drop after migration?

If you keep the same URLs, maintain proper redirects, and submit the new sitemap, rankings should remain stable. Monitor Console for crawl errors.

Can I migrate multiple domains at once?

Yes. Use Bluehost’s Bulk Transfer tool in the Domains section to add several domains, then repeat the migration steps for each site.

Is there a limit on the size of the site I can move?

Bluehost’s shared plans support sites up to 50 GB of storage. Larger sites may need a VPS or dedicated plan.

What if the migration fails?

Restore your backup on the old host, double‑check the database credentials, and run the plugin again. Bluehost support can also assist.

Conclusion & CTA

Migrating to Bluehost doesn’t have to be a headache. By following this guide—backing up, using the one‑click plugin or manual steps, and completing a thorough post‑migration audit—you’ll enjoy faster performance, reliable support, and a platform that scales with your growth.

Ready to make the switch? Sign up for a Bluehost plan today, and let our 24/7 experts help you migrate your site in minutes.

Comments are closed, but trackbacks and pingbacks are open.